Howard Stern Ups Feud with Leno: He’s a Robot and I Don’t Like Him

Jun 10, 2009  •  Post A Comment

In the latest appearance on the “Late Show with David Letterman” Howard Stern, the self-declared  king of all media took more potshots at one of his favorite targets, Jay Leno, ABC News reports.

In other Leno news, the former late night host is already doing promos for his new primetime slot on NBC, and some of those promos will be mini-monologues, Variety reports.
